Hi.   Haven't used my Surge for some months and it needs synching.  Problem is, I can't remember how to synch on my PC (Win 7).  Have checked dashboard and settings but can't find any "button" that starts the synch process.

Where in the account do I go for synching?

On the PC you need to open the fitbot connect software and sync it that way

 

Use the fitbit Icon in your system tray Or use Start/All Programs/Fitbit Connect. Open the Main Menu and choose Sync Now.
